  • 8 GB + 2 GB Macbook Pro late 2011 - Possible?

    Hey,.

    I bought a bar of 8 GB 1333 Mhz of Crucial to add to my Macbook Pro 13 ", end 2011, which currently has 4 GB. Only after I ordered it, I realized that the 4 GB came in 2 + 2GB sticks. A rookie mistake, I know.

    My question is this: is it possible to get the 8 GB in a RAM slot and keep the 2 GB in the other, for a total of 10 GB? Or is it better to let the one with 8 GB?

    I know that Apple in its recommendations stipulates that the maximum is 4 + 4GB, but Crucial and many other users have used up to 16 GB in such a MBP without problems and optimize performance. Can someone provide feedback on which would be the best option?

    Thank you
    Vasco

    MacBook Pro (13 inch, late 2011)

    2.4 GHz Intel Core i5

    Intel HD Graphics 3000 384

    4 GB 1333 MHz DDR3

    Install it.  It will work and be beneficial.  That said, it is not as effective as a set of RAM of capacity equal.  Yield loss will be 10%-15%.

    When the bank account permits, order another 8 GB module and then install it for a pair of 16 GB.  That's what I have in my 2011 Mbps.

    Ciao.

    Addendum: I should make it obvious that you should also keep a module of 2 GB for a total of 10 GB of RAM.

  • Double disc SSD/HDD on MacBook Pro late 2011

    So I finally finished putting my double drive on my MacBook Pro late 2011. I ended up putting the SSD where the optical drive has been, since research told me that the end 2011 MBP is the lucky model with an optical drive that supports Sata III. If anyone can give me a reason to spend my SSD and HDD, please let me know.

    Anyway, now I ask to help with setting up my macbook pro to use two disks. I copied everything on the SSD and the SSD drive is set to start my computer to the top. I can already tell that this thing is so much faster now. However, I basically just have two exact copies of my all my stuff on the two disks. How can I configure my computer to know which drive to use? I want a few things to use my HARD drive and other things to use my SDD, not all at once. Where are these settings and how to do?

    Thank you in advance!

    Hi Jdsr4c:

    I have a Macbook Pro 2011 start.

    I installed a 500 GB Samsung 850 EVO instead of HD.

    I moved the HD to the optical Bay.

    Optical Bay has 3 Gigabit speed. HD space has a 6 Gigabit speed.

    See the screenshots of my mac.

    The old HD, I would reformat is not bootable.

    I use my old HD for storage of movies, etc.

    So for example, I'll download a movie and then move it to my old hard drive. I'll put it in a directory named for example movies.

    On the SSD, I'll do an 'Alias' pointing to the movies on the old HD directory (on windows, it would be a shortcut).

    In any case, hope this helps.
